On Thu, Jul 11, 2019 at 07:43:56PM -0400, Joel Fernandes (Google) wrote:
> +int rcu_read_lock_any_held(void)
> +{
> +     int lockdep_opinion = 0;
> +
> +     if (!debug_lockdep_rcu_enabled())
> +             return 1;
> +     if (!rcu_is_watching())
> +             return 0;
> +     if (!rcu_lockdep_current_cpu_online())
> +             return 0;
> +
> +     /* Preemptible RCU flavor */
> +     if (lock_is_held(&rcu_lock_map))

you forgot debug_locks here.

> +             return 1;
> +
> +     /* BH flavor */
> +     if (in_softirq() || irqs_disabled())

I'm not sure I'd put irqs_disabled() under BH, also this entire
condition is superfluous, see below.

> +             return 1;
> +
> +     /* Sched flavor */
> +     if (debug_locks)
> +             lockdep_opinion = lock_is_held(&rcu_sched_lock_map);
> +     return lockdep_opinion || !preemptible();

that !preemptible() turns into:

  !(preempt_count()==0 && !irqs_disabled())

which is:

  preempt_count() != 0 || irqs_disabled()

and already includes irqs_disabled() and in_softirq().

> +}

So maybe something lke:

        if (debug_locks && (lock_is_held(&rcu_lock_map) ||
                            lock_is_held(&rcu_sched_lock_map)))
                return true;

        return !preemptible();
